Artist's Description

A very hot forest fire just south of the California/Oregon border created this pyrocumulus cloud at sunset. A similar cloud built up enough to create lightning a few weeks earlier. The clouds and smoke kept the fire fighting planes and helicopters from flying.

About Mick Anderson

Mick Anderson

While in college, Mick had the opportunity to work at St. Mary Lodge at the east entrance to Glacier National Park in Montana. It was in this magical place where he met several fellow students from other parts of the country who would change the direction of his life by introducing Mick to nature, the mountains, the guitar and singing, fly fishing, writing music, hiking, and -- most importantly -- the Single Lens Reflex camera! He had a chance to play with Pentacon, Yashica, Pentax, Nikon and other brands, leading cameras of the day. It opened up a whole new way of looking at the world, and started a hobby that quickly grew into a passion that has stood the test of many years. His first real camera was a Yashica Electro-35...
